About Benjamin Fisch

Benjamin Fisch is a scholar working on Public Health, Environmental and Occupational Health, Reproductive Medicine, Pediatrics, Perinatology and Child Health, Molecular Biology and Immunology, having authored 166 papers that have together received 3.6k indexed citations. Recurring topics across this work include Reproductive Biology and Fertility (65 papers), Ovarian function and disorders (39 papers), Sperm and Testicular Function (17 papers), Assisted Reproductive Technology and Twin Pregnancy (17 papers), Reproductive System and Pregnancy (11 papers), Reproductive Health and Technologies (10 papers), Ectopic Pregnancy Diagnosis and Management (7 papers) and Renal and related cancers (6 papers). The work is most often cited by research in Reproductive Medicine (1.5k citations), Public Health, Environmental and Occupational Health (2.1k citations), Obstetrics and Gynecology (169 citations), Pediatrics, Perinatology and Child Health (380 citations) and Immunology (279 citations). Benjamin Fisch has collaborated with scholars based in Israel, Canada and United States. Frequent co-authors include Ronit Abir, Avi Ben‐Haroush, Shmuel Nitke, Carmela Felz, Jardena Ovadia, Raoul Orvieto, Onit Sapir, Haim Pinkas, Jacob Farhi and Yona Tadir. Their work appears in journals such as Fertility and Sterility, Journal of Assisted Reproduction and Genetics, Reproductive BioMedicine Online, Human Reproduction and International Journal of Radiation Oncology*Biology*Physics.
